The too much income disparities among different industries has drawn the attentions from all walks of life, but the quantitative researches in the academic world with some systematic methods on such problem are rare, and most of the current literatures are researches based the view of system factors.There are many factors affect the industry income gap, and we have chosen the monopoly level differences, the industrial level differences and differences in labor standards as the industry’s income gap to be analyzed. In order to make a more systematic analysis, I collect data of19industries between2003and2010to get the income gap between the status quo trends, causes and impact of China’s industry and the analysis showed that the wage gap in recent years has expanded. The industry’s monopoly level differences and the difference of the level of industrial level are the main causes of industry wage differentials.In order to analysis the economic effects of the industries’income gap on consumption, investment, financial development, economic growth. I use the stationary test in econometrics, cointegration, Granger causality, vector auto-regression model, impulse response function method. The effects of test results show the industries" income gap effects of China’s consumer spending in short-run is positive, but the medium and the total effect is negative; The effects of spending on investment and financial development in short-term, medium-term and the overall effects are negative; on economic growth, whether it is from the short, medium, or the overall results, the effects are negative. Finally, policy recommendations on reducing the industry income gap is regulating monopolies income distribution, improving the wage distribution system, establishing a sound social security system, and vigorously developing the tertiary industry.
